Why Remote Start and Climate Control Matter in Winter
When temperatures plummet, remote start allows you to warm up your car before you even leave your house. Not only does this make for a more comfortable ride, but it also helps with ice and snow removal, improving safety. Climate control systems, particularly dual-zone or tri-zone setups, ensure that every passenger stays at their ideal temperature, making winter driving much more enjoyable.
Features to Look for in a Winter-Ready Vehicle
Advanced Remote Start Systems
Modern remote start systems allow you to warm up your car from a distance, ensuring that you step into a comfortable and defrosted vehicle. Some models even integrate with smartphone apps, enabling you to activate climate control settings remotely for added convenience.
Intelligent Climate Control
Look for a vehicle equipped with automatic climate control that maintains a steady temperature inside the cabin. Some systems adjust heating and airflow automatically based on external conditions, keeping passengers comfortable even in extreme cold.
Enhanced Safety Features for Winter Driving
Beyond comfort, safety is a major concern for winter driving. Vehicles with advanced driver-assistance systems make navigating icy roads easier and safer. Here are some essential features to consider:
-
Traction Control System (TCS): Helps prevent wheel spin on slippery roads by adjusting engine power and braking force.
-
Anti-Lock Braking System (ABS): Prevents wheels from locking up during sudden braking, allowing for better steering control on icy or wet surfaces.
-
Snow Mode Settings: Adjusts throttle response and transmission shifts to enhance stability and control in snowy or icy conditions.
-
All-Wheel Drive (AWD) or Four-Wheel Drive (4WD): Provides better grip and handling in challenging winter conditions.
-
Heated Features: Heated steering wheels, seats, and mirrors add to the comfort factor, ensuring you stay warm even in the coldest weather.
Choosing the Right Winter-Ready Car for You
When shopping for a car with great winter features, consider how often you’ll need remote start and climate control. If you live in a region with harsh winters, a vehicle with a powerful heating system, heated seats, and a responsive defrost function is a must.
Additionally, features like smartphone integration for remote functions and intelligent safety systems can further enhance your winter driving experience.
